WebEvery life insurer licensed to do business in New York State must be a member of the Guaranty Fund as a condition of doing an insurance business in the state. The Guaranty Fund is funded through assessments against member insurers made after a member insurer is declared insolvent by a court of law. The limit in … docwire careersWebNYSIF is a self-supporting insurance carrier that competes with private insurers in the workers' compensation and disability benefits markets. Operating income is derived solely from insurance premiums and investments. NYSIF is the largest provider of workers' compensation insurance in New York State. doc wine and foodWebMar 14, 2024 · When an insurance company is having a liquidity problem, the state puts it into rehabilitation and tries to save it from becoming insolvent.
